    Minor carnage

    My Capri wasn't quite up to its normal self at Quaker. Ran pretty flat both time trials, then fell dead flat the first round of eliminations. Got the thing home and did a compression check ... #1 hole was pretty dead.

    Started to tear into it tonight and found the culprit. This is the HLA from #1 intake. The good news is I got all the parts ...



    I have also had a small exhaust leak that got substantially worse on the last pass. After dealing with cracks in the old tube header I expected something cracked. Pulled the assembly off and no cracks (good news). Pulled the turbo and found the culprit ...



    I have the parts on hand and am going to throw a fresh set of valve springs on it while I'm at it.

    As you all suspect, it is RPM related. The 2.3 has a lash adjuster on one side and a spring on the other with the cam in the middle (I think a 4.6 is similar?) When you are turning it hard, or cranking launch RPM into it, the spring needs to be able to control the valve or the HLA's will "pump up" to try and take up the slack ... If you go into major float, they will occasioanlly toss the follower out because the HLA can't move enough ... This one just happened to get wedged in there when it spit it out and broke it :(

    Fortunately, this answers a number of questions. Sunday it bogged a little on the first pass, I gave it 100 more RPM and it was worse. For eliminations I gave it more and it puked ... So i'm going up in spring pressure with the new springs. This answers that issue. Hopefully I wont need those RPM anyway with the gasket fixed ... I never go over 6500 RPM rev limit, this was at 6800 (shift at 6200).

    The other thing I've been chasing is this bog after the hit ... part of it was likely related to the valve float, but I was also loosing turbine drive energy from the burned out SS gasket ... Hopefully it can recover quicker now.

    So between needing higher seat pressure and the leak .... I might have fixed a few issues ;)

    I love the Precission turbo. My last one was one of their "SC50's" and I got a lot of years and passes from it. This one is a 5557 with their billet compressor wheel. It's only 1 mm bigger but spools faster than the old SC50 and will support about 40 more HP (not that I'm maxing it out now). No ball bearing turbos for me, I just don't see the point, especially with these new billet wheels.
